>> (For the interested newbies like myself: classes have a constructor
>> that you
>> can use to specify the parent, and the attributes, so when I changed
>> my call to:
>> var v = new hrule(parent, {width: this.parent.width,
>> bgcolor: this.linecolor});
>> it was happy.)
